Wynwood Walls
One of Miami's most iconic cultural landmarks, Wynwood Walls transformed former warehouse exteriors into an open-air museum featuring large-scale murals by internationally renowned street artists.
Museum of Graffiti
Located in the heart of Wynwood, the Museum of Graffiti is the world's first museum dedicated exclusively to graffiti art and culture.

Rubell Museum
Housed within a repurposed industrial campus near Wynwood, the Rubell Museum features one of the world's most significant private collections of contemporary art.
Institute of Contemporary Art, Miami (ICA Miami)
Located in the Miami Design District, ICA Miami offers free admission and presents cutting-edge exhibitions featuring emerging and established contemporary artists.
The Margulies Collection at the Warehouse
This renowned nonprofit exhibition space showcases an exceptional collection of contemporary and vintage photography, sculpture, video, and installation art.

Bayfront Park
Situated along Biscayne Bay, Bayfront Park is a 32-acre waterfront green space offering walking paths, public art, gardens, event venues, and scenic views of the Miami skyline.
